Macon, Mississippi · MaconMACON, Miss. (WCBI) – Freddie Poindexter will remain in office as Mayor of Macon. Special Circuit Judge Jeff Weill has denied Lillian Gillespie’s objections to the outcome of the city’s Mayoral Election. Gillespie lost to Poindexter in the Democratic Primary Runoff back in April. Macon, Mississippi · MaconMACON, Miss. (WCBI) – A school building in Macon gets a new mission and a new life. The former B.F. Liddell Middle School is the new home to Earl Nash Elementary School. The historic building, which underwent a multi-million dollar renovation, will retain the B.F. Liddell name.
